0:18.2 | Google announced on Tuesday it's releasing Android 15 and making its source code available ahead of the |
0:24.8 | coming consumer launch, which will bring the new mobile operating system to supported |
0:28.9 | Pixel devices in the coming weeks. |
0:31.4 | The company also revealed that Android 15 will launch on select devices from Samsung |
0:36.0 | Honor, Lenovo, Motorola, Nothing, One Plus Apo, Real Me, Sharp, Sony, Techno, Vivo, and Shoume in the coming months. |
0:45.0 | The Android update will bring new editions like Private Space, a feature that lets users |
0:49.6 | silo a portion of the operating system for sensitive information. |
0:54.7 | The software update will also allow users to save their favorite split screen |
0:58.7 | app combinations for quick access and pin the taskbar permanently on the screen. |
1:04.2 | Other additions include partial screen recording and more convenient pass keys. |
1:09.1 | As part of Tuesday's announcement, Google reveal that it's making Android 15 available on the Android Open |
1:14.2 | Source Project, which provides the information and source code needed to create custom versions |
1:19.1 | of the Android OS, port devices, and accessories to the Android platform and ensure compatibility requirements. |
1:25.6 | Android 15 gives developers access to improved typography and internalization |
1:30.7 | along with camera and media improvements. |
1:33.0 | Google's also making most app facing changes opt in to give developers more time to make necessary |
1:39.2 | app changes before their app targets SDK version 35. |
